What is a weighted column in Blackboard?

The WEIGHTED TOTAL column enables instructors to set the weight (or value) of individual assignments and assignment categories independent of the number of points in an assignment. If you set every assignment to 100 points but count one assignment as 10% and another as 25%, this is the column for you.

What is simple weighted mean of grades?

Simple Weighted Mean (recommended) - The difference between this aggregation method and 'Weighted mean of grades' is that the weight of each item is simply its maximum grade. A 100 point assignment has a weight of 100; a 10 point assignment has a weight of 10; items with higher total scores are weighted greater.

How do you weight grades?

Multiply the grade on the assignment by the grade weight. In the example, 85 times 20 percent equals 17 and 100 times 80 percent equals 80. Add together all your weighted grades to find your overall grade. In the example, 17 points plus 80 points equals a weighted grade of 97.Apr 24, 2017

What is the difference between total and weighted total?

Weighted Total vs. Total: the two columns are created by default in every Blackboard space. The Total column shows the number of points attained out of the total possible. The Weighted Total shows the current total as determined by the weighting scheme set in the Edit Column Information page as above.

How do you find the weighted total?

To find a weighted average, multiply each number by its weight, then add the results. If the weights don't add up to one, find the sum of all the variables multiplied by their weight, then divide by the sum of the weights.Oct 27, 2021
